如何配置MySQL数据库以实现有效的监控项管理?

配置MySQL监控项通常包括:查询缓存命中率、InnoDB缓冲池命中率、查询执行时间、锁等待时间、连接数、线程/进程使用情况、复制状态等。这些监控项可以帮助你了解数据库的性能和健康状况。

对于MySQL数据库的监控,采取有效的监控策略是确保数据库稳定运行和及时响应潜在问题的关键,在当下,有诸多工具和手段可以用于监控MySQL的性能与健康状态,其中Prometheus与Grafana的组合使用就是一种常见的选择,通过配置特定的监控项,可以更加精准地获取关于数据库运行状态的信息,小编将详细介绍如何配置MySQL的监控项以及相关工具的使用:

mysql数据库监控_配置Mysql监控项
(图片来源网络,侵删)

1、监控工具的选择

开源工具:可以选择如Prometheus这类开源监控工具,Prometheus是一个强大的开源监控工具,它能够收集和存储时间序列数据,配合Grafana使用,可以实现数据的可视化展示。

企业级工具:对于一些需要更为专业或具有定制化需求的环境,可以考虑使用如MySQL Enterprise Monitor、Paessler PRTG Network Monitor等企业级监控工具,这些工具往往提供更丰富的功能,比如性能指标监视、分布式跟踪等。

2、监控项的配置

安装配置:首先需要安装并配置所选的监控工具,使用Prometheus时,需要安装mysql_exporter来收集MySQL的监控数据。

mysql数据库监控_配置Mysql监控项
(图片来源网络,侵删)

数据收集:配置完成后,即可开始收集MySQL数据库的各项指标,包括查询次数、慢查询比例、连接数等关键性能指标。

数据展示:通过Grafana等可视化工具,可以将收集到的数据以图表的形式展现出来,帮助运维人员更直观地了解数据库的运行状态。

3、实时监控系统的应用

HertzBeat的使用:除了传统的监控工具外,还可以考虑使用HertzBeat这类实时监控系统,HertzBeat提供了监控告警通知的一体化解决方案,使得操作更加便捷,只需简单的点击操作就可以将MySQL数据库纳入监控并实现告警通知。

4、分布式监控的支持

mysql数据库监控_配置Mysql监控项
(图片来源网络,侵删)

多主机监控:在分布式环境下,监控工具应支持对多台主机上的MySQL数据库进行集中监控,确保数据的完整性和监控的全面性。

5、监控指标的细化

系统性能指标:包括但不限于CPU使用率、内存占用、磁盘I/O等,这些都是影响数据库性能的重要因素。

数据库性能指标:如查询缓存命中率、索引使用情况、InnoDB缓冲池的大小及命中率等,直接关联数据库的性能表现。

配置MySQL监控项需要选择合适的监控工具,并进行相应的安装与配置,根据数据库的特性和业务需求,选取关键的性能指标进行监控,并利用如Grafana这样的工具对收集到的数据进行可视化展示,以便于运维人员及时发现并解决问题。

相关问题与解答

Q1: Prometheus与Grafana在MySQL监控中各自承担什么角色?

A1: 在该监控框架中,Prometheus主要负责收集和存储MySQL数据库的性能指标数据,而Grafana则用于将这些数据以图表的形式展现出来,使数据分析更为直观。

Q2: 使用HertzBeat进行MySQL数据库监控有哪些优势?

A2: HertzBeat的优势在于其提供的监控告警通知一体化解决方案,用户界面友好,操作简单,能够迅速将MySQL数据库纳入监控体系并实现自动告警与通知。

通过对MySQL数据库的细致监控,可以有效地保障数据库的稳定运行,并在出现问题时快速响应,这对于维护高可用性和高性能的数据库服务至关重要。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-08-11 05:30
下一篇 2024-08-11 05:35

相关推荐

  • 梦幻武神坛冠军服务器的奖励有哪些?

    梦幻武神坛冠军服务器的奖励包括专属称谓、专属徽章、专属聊天气泡、专属空间皮肤、专属头像框、专属空间挂件以及专属空间背景音乐。这些奖励旨在提升获胜服务器玩家的身份象征和社交体验,增强游戏内的荣誉感和归属感。

    2024-08-19
    005
  • 主机服务器在现代网络中扮演着什么关键角色?

    主机服务器是计算机的一种,它比普通计算机运行更快、负载更高、价格更贵。服务器在网络中为其它客户机(如PC机、智能手机、ATM等终端甚至是火车系统等大型设备)提供计算或者应用服务。

    2024-07-21
    005
  • 印象笔记同步报错怎么办?解决方法与常见问题解析

    印象笔记同步报错是许多用户在使用过程中常遇到的问题,这类错误不仅影响工作效率,还可能导致数据丢失或不同步的困扰,本文将详细分析印象笔记同步报错的常见原因、解决方法及预防措施,帮助用户快速解决问题并优化使用体验,同步报错的常见原因印象笔记同步报错通常由多种因素导致,以下是几种最常见的情况:网络连接问题网络不稳定或……

    2025-09-28
    006
  • 我服务器开启了cdn是什么意思

    开启CDN意味着您的服务器内容将通过一个内容分发网络(Content Delivery Network)进行缓存和加速,使用户能从离他们最近的节点获取数据,从而加快访问速度并减轻原始服务器的负载。

    2024-07-12
    005

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信